How to multiply 7/8 by 8/6?
- Multiply both numerators together: 7 × 8 = 56
- Multiply both denominators together: 8 × 6 = 48
- Combine the results to get the new fraction: 56/48
- Simplify the fraction (56/48) by dividing both the numerator and the denominator by their GCD (8):
- 56/8 = 7
- 48/8 = 6
- This gives: 7/6.
The result of multiplying 7/8 with 8/6 is : 7/6 (or 1.1666666666667 in its decimal form)
